Introduction

The Robotics and Computer Vision Challenge is an International Competition, technically co-sponsored by IEEE, which aims to gather participants from academia and industry working in the field of robotics, computer vision, and related areas.
The competition welcomes innovative contributions unfolding technical advances in the area of autonomous robotics: Original ideas and designs, novel discoveries and enhancements, new applications on the latest fundamental advances in computer vision, as well as outstanding developmental projects.
This competition is organized within the 5th International Conference on Multimedia Computing and Systems (ICMCS’16), to be held at Kenzi-Farah Hotel in Marrakech, Morocco from 29 September to 1st October 2016.
Robotics and Computer Vision Challenge is a call for innovative technologies, or realizations in robotics domain. The contest is open to teams worldwide who are able to present a project that has been already prototyped and tested experimentally. Projects to be submitted to the challenge are expected to be based on computer vision techniques.
All selected Finalist Teams will be invited to register online in order to defend their projects on September 28th, 2016, and participate & exhibit their realizations in the ICMCS’16 September 29-30, 2016.
An international jury of renowned experts will select the 3 best projects among finalists and the winners will get valuable prizes.
